Latin, for a language employed by the educated, and also the language of the Anglo-Saxons equally experienced a profound effect on the spelling and pronunciation of Norman names in Britain. On the other hand, the Norman language afflicted the development of English. Given that the English language designed from its Germanic roots into Middle English (which was motivated by Norman French) we find a period in the course of which spelling was not standardised but approximately followed phonetic pronunciation. During this time names were being spelled various methods dependent on nearby dialects. Consequently the surname, plus the Anglo-Saxon names, ended up recorded in many various strategies.[ten]

Jacques is through the Latin identify Jacobus. It's really a masculine title that means "supplanter" or "a single who follows". It is usually linked to the Hebrew title Yaakov, meaning "he who supplants".[two]
